What a boxing focused trainer offers

Opting for a dedicated coach who specialises in striking and movement can transform both technique and conditioning. A Personal Trainer For Boxing helps personalise drills that sharpen footwork, balance, and hand speed while safeguarding joints with smart progression. Expect a plan that blends pad work, bag sessions, and Personal Trainer For Boxing sport specific conditioning so you improve both power and accuracy. The right trainer also teaches core concepts such as stance, guard, and shoulder alignment to reduce wasted energy during combos. Consistent sessions nurture rhythm, timing, and confidence in the ring.

Designing your training plan for combat readiness

A well structured programme targets progression across three pillars: technique, power, and stamina. A Personal Trainer For Boxing will tailor workouts to your current level, then step up complexity as you adapt. You should see a balanced mix of technical drills, conditioning circuits, and tactical sparring that mirrors competitive scenarios. Scheduling regular check ins keeps goals realistic and ensures you steadily close gaps between what you can execute in practice and what is needed in competition.

Equipment and techniques that make a difference

Quality gear, from gloves to focus mitts, supports efficient technique and reduces the risk of injury. A qualified coach will teach you how to use the ring space, manage pace, and conserve energy during rounds. Emphasis on breathing, foot placement, and hip rotation helps you deliver clean, powerful shots without overreaching. Expect feedback that translates to faster adaptations in the bag and on pads, so you feel more in control during every sequence.

How to choose the right boxing coach

Begin with a clear set of goals, then interview potential trainers about their approach, experience, and how they measure progress. A Personal Trainer For Boxing should value technique first, with a plan that evolves as you improve. Look for trainers who emphasise injury prevention, smart recovery, and sustainable training loads. If possible, observe a session or request a sample workout to gauge coaching style, communication, and the ability to push you without overdoing it in a single week.
